파이썬에서는 class라는 키워드를 사용하여 클래스 정의
클래스의 구조
class 클래스_네임:
def __init__(self, 인수, ...): # 생성자
...
def method_name1(self, 인수, ...): # 메서드1
...
def method_name2(self, 인수, ...): # 메서드2
...
예시
class Man:
def __init__(self, name): # init: class reset
self.name = name # 인스턴스 변수 초기화
print("Initialized!")
def hello(self):
print("Hello " + self.name + "!")
def goodbye(self):
print("Bye " + self.name + "!")
m = Man("Jin")
m.hello()
m.goodbye()
당신의 시간이 헛되지 않는 글이 되겠습니다.
I'll write something that won't waste your time.